TIFIN.AI has set up TIFIN Australia, extending its overseas presence as it continues to build out its operations beyond existing markets.
The move comes after the company’s earlier expansion into Japan and India
The new operation is part of its wider effort to pair its AI capabilities in wealth services with local management and partnerships. TIFIN Australia has been established as a joint venture between TIFIN.AI and an executive team headed by Marcus Price, the former chief executive of Iress and Pexa, who takes the role of executive chairman. Justin Schmitt, previously chief operating officer of Iress, has been appointed chief executive.
The Australian business will run independently under Price. The company said it intends to introduce AI-based technology already in use in the US and other markets to the Australian wealth sector. Its focus will be on AI-native systems for financial advisers, wealth managers and enterprises in Australia, aimed at supporting more personalised and scalable financial advice.
